Marina valet storage services in the United States are designed to provide convenient, secure, and efficient storage solutions for boat owners. These services are typically offered by marinas or specialized storage companies and cater to those who seek to protect their vessels and simplify the logistics of boating. Here’s a description and the typical specifications of a marina valet storage service:

Description:

Marina Valet Storage is a comprehensive service aimed at boat owners who seek hassle-free storage and handling of their vessels. The service includes the retrieval, launching, and storage of boats, all managed by marina staff. The primary goal is to provide a seamless experience, alleviating the burden on boat owners and ensuring their boats are well-maintained and readily available when needed.

Specifications:

  1. Storage Facilities:

    • Dry Stack Storage: Multi-level racks for storing boats out of the water, protecting them from the elements.
    • Wet Slips: Dock spaces for those who prefer to keep their boats in the water.
    • Climate-Controlled Options: Indoor storage with controlled temperature and humidity, ideal for high-value vessels and sensitive equipment.
  2. Boat Size Accommodation:

    • Typically accommodates boats ranging from small dinghies to larger powerboats and sailboats.
    • Capacity to store boats up to around 40 feet in length, though some facilities may accommodate larger yachts.
  3. Valet Services:

    • Launch and Retrieval: Professional staff use forklifts, cranes, or other equipment to move boats between storage and the water.
    • Fueling Services: Refueling of boats to ensure they are ready for use.
    • Cleaning and Maintenance: Offering washing, detailing, and even engine maintenance services.
    • Seasonal Services: Winterization and spring commissioning to prepare boats for different seasons.
  4. Security:

    • 24/7 surveillance with security cameras.
    • On-site security personnel.
    • Gated access to storage areas, often with keycard or passcode entry.
  5. Convenience Features:

    • Online Reservation and Scheduling: Boat owners can schedule pick-ups and launches via an online portal or mobile app.
    • Extended Hours: Some facilities offer extended or 24/7 access to accommodate varied schedules.
    • Customer Support: Dedicated support staff to handle inquiries and special requests.
  6. Additional Amenities:

    • Showers and changing rooms.
    • Lounge areas and sometimes on-site dining.
    • Repair shops and nautical supply stores.
  7. Location and Access:

    • Ideally located near popular boating areas, marinas, and waterways for easy access.
    • Well-maintained roadways for trailer access if applicable.
  8. Membership Plans:

    • Various tiers of membership or subscription plans, offering different levels of service and access.
    • Discounts for long-term storage commitments or bundled services.
